What is the difference between Ghirardelli melting wafers and chips?
Wafers make perfect melting chocolate. Unlike, chips, they do not hold their shape. They melt smoothly and set up firmly when used. Some wafers, like the A’Peels and the Snaps, do not need to be tempered.
Can you bake with melting wafers?
They’re perfect for melting as a coating because they don’t contain stabilizers. Wafers are fantastic for unbaked goodies like ganache, puddings, frostings, and coating around candies. Unlike baking chocolate, I don’t recommend wafers for actual baked recipes. You want to reach for chocolate that is made for baking.

What are baking wafers?
Wafers are a crisp, thin, aerated baked good with characteristic surface reeds. They are commonly filled with a cream paste of vanilla, chocolate, hazelnut or other inclusions. 1. Wafers can also be made gluten-free.
How do they make wafers?
Wafers are formed from flour and water dispersions (batter) with small amounts of fat, sugar, salt and sodium bicarbonate, which are mixed and then confined in preheated moulds3. Yeast may be used in place or in addition to sodium bicarbonate.
Does Kraft own Nabisco?
Reynolds in 1985 and becoming part of RJR Nabisco, Nabisco was sold in 2000 to Philip Morris Companies (renamed Altria Group, Inc.), which was the parent company of Kraft Foods. Nabisco’s brands were thereafter marketed by Kraft.
